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Support
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
J
jiedao-api-boot-master
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
lanbaoming
jiedao-api-boot-master
Commits
f0c3f018
Commit
f0c3f018
authored
May 23, 2024
by
lanbaoming
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
2024-05-23-4提交
parent
8200e450
Changes
1
Show wh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
25 additions
and
0 deletions
+25
-0
CustomerContactsController.java
...er/admin/customerContacts/CustomerContactsController.java
+25
-0
No files found.
yudao-module-customer/yudao-module-customer-rest/src/main/java/cn/iocoder/yudao/module/customer/controller/admin/customerContacts/CustomerContactsController.java
View file @
f0c3f018
...
@@ -132,6 +132,7 @@ public class CustomerContactsController {
...
@@ -132,6 +132,7 @@ public class CustomerContactsController {
ExcelUtils
.
write
(
response
,
"客户联系人.xls"
,
"数据"
,
CustomerContactsExcelVO
.
class
,
datas
);
ExcelUtils
.
write
(
response
,
"客户联系人.xls"
,
"数据"
,
CustomerContactsExcelVO
.
class
,
datas
);
}
}
@GetMapping
(
"/select"
)
@GetMapping
(
"/select"
)
@ApiOperation
(
"获得客户联系人下拉框列表(单次最多显示20条,请输入联系人电话、联系人姓名、客户名称搜索)"
)
@ApiOperation
(
"获得客户联系人下拉框列表(单次最多显示20条,请输入联系人电话、联系人姓名、客户名称搜索)"
)
@ApiImplicitParams
({
@ApiImplicitParams
({
...
@@ -147,6 +148,30 @@ public class CustomerContactsController {
...
@@ -147,6 +148,30 @@ public class CustomerContactsController {
@RequestParam
(
value
=
"customerId"
,
required
=
false
)
Long
customerId
@RequestParam
(
value
=
"customerId"
,
required
=
false
)
Long
customerId
,
PageParam
page
)
{
,
PageParam
page
)
{
Long
loginUserId
=
SecurityFrameworkUtils
.
getLoginUserId
();
return
success
(
customerContactsService
.
selectBySearchKey
(
searchKey
,
type
,
ids
,
customerId
,
page
));
}
/*
lanbm 2024-05-23 添加的新的功能接口
用于报价单逻辑控制
*/
@GetMapping
(
"/select2"
)
@ApiOperation
(
"获得客户联系人下拉框列表(单次最多显示20条,请输入联系人电话、联系人姓名、客户名称搜索)"
)
@ApiImplicitParams
({
@ApiImplicitParam
(
name
=
"searchKey"
,
value
=
"请输入联系人电话、联系人姓名、客户名称搜索"
,
example
=
"姓名或电话"
,
dataTypeClass
=
String
.
class
),
@ApiImplicitParam
(
name
=
"type"
,
value
=
"客户类型"
,
example
=
"姓名或电话"
,
dataTypeClass
=
String
.
class
),
@ApiImplicitParam
(
name
=
"ids"
,
value
=
"编号列表"
,
example
=
"1024,2048"
,
dataTypeClass
=
List
.
class
),
@ApiImplicitParam
(
name
=
"customerId"
,
value
=
"客户ID"
,
example
=
"1024"
,
dataTypeClass
=
Long
.
class
)
})
public
CommonResult
<
PageResult
<
CustomerContactsDto
>>
selectBySearchKey2
(
@RequestParam
(
value
=
"searchKey"
,
required
=
false
)
String
searchKey
,
@RequestParam
(
value
=
"type"
,
required
=
false
)
String
type
,
@RequestParam
(
value
=
"ids"
,
required
=
false
)
Collection
<
Long
>
ids
,
@RequestParam
(
value
=
"customerId"
,
required
=
false
)
Long
customerId
,
PageParam
page
)
{
//lanbm 2024-05-22修改报价单联系人选择
//lanbm 2024-05-22修改报价单联系人选择
/*
/*
return success(customerContactsService.selectBySearchKey(searchKey,
return success(customerContactsService.selectBySearchKey(searchKey,
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ment